Definition of IRREFRAGABLE
ir·re·fra·ga·ble adjective \i-ˈre-frə-gə-bəl, ˌi(r)-; ˌir-i-ˈfra-gə-\
1: impossible to refute <irrefragable arguments>
2: impossible to break or alter <irrefragable rules>
— ir·re·fra·ga·bil·i·ty noun
— ir·ref·ra·ga·bly adverb

In 2009, President Obama issued a presidential proclamation declaring October, National Information Literacy Awareness Month, calling upon all Americans to recognize that “the ability to seek, find, and decipher information can be applied to countless life decisions, whether financial, medical, educational, or technical…An informed and educated citizenry is essential to the functioning of our modern democratic society.”
